Current USD/JPY Trend Analysis and Trading Recommendations

99
On Wednesday, the USD/JPY attracted buyers for the second consecutive day, trading near 145.20 in the early European session, close to a two-week high. Japan's May CGPI rose 3.2% YoY, the slowest pace since September last year, potentially easing BOJ rate hike pressure and weakening the JPY. Additionally, optimism over a framework agreement in U.S.-China trade talks dented the JPY's safe-haven appeal. Technically, the price holds above the 200-period SMA on the 4-hour chart and breaches the 145.00 psychological level, with oscillators tilting bullish. A valid break above 145.30 (Tuesday's high) would confirm the bullish setup, targeting the 146.00 integer mark and 146.25-146.30 resistance zone.
